A student behaving inappropriately is one issue and a teacher sleeping with a student is an entirely different issue.
Teachers are adults, professionals and authority figures who are expected to exercise maturity, self control and good judgment. That is exactly why codes of conduct exist. If a student is making advances, the teacher's responsibility is to reject them, set boundaries and report the matter where necessary not engage in a relationship.
No profession excuses misconduct by saying “I was tempted.” Accountability comes with the position. Students can be corrected for inappropriate behavior but the greater responsibility always rests with the adult who is entrusted with their care and education.
So while we can acknowledge that some students may cross boundaries, that should never be used to shift responsibility away from teachers who choose to violate professional and ethical standards.
